Report Highlights the Effects of 24-Hour Connectivity
Relying heavily on mobile technology to stay connected to their work and personal lives is creating “mobile guilt” among professionals, who then resort to “shadow tasking,” according to a new global online survey of 3,521 professionals.
Shadow tasking allows this new hyper-connected workforce—typically men 18-34 and parents with children at home under the age of 18—to use their smartphones or tablets to meet the demands of both worlds. It’s happening extensively across six countries—the U.S., U.K., France, Germany, Japan and Spain.
